Types of Available Formats
There are several formats to choose from, each offering distinct benefits. The right choice largely depends on your scheduling style and how you plan to organize your days or weeks. Below is a comparison of common options:
Format | Best For | Features |
---|---|---|
Linear Layout | Individuals with a busy schedule | Simple design, ideal for quick overviews and easy task allocation |
Grid Layout | Those who need a detailed, structured view | Multiple sections for tasks, appointments, and reminders |
Time-Specific Layout | Professionals with specific time slots | Hourly breakdown, best for meetings, appointments, and time-blocking |
Task-Oriented Layout | People who focus on to-do lists | Emphasis on tasks, deadlines, and priorities |

Popular Platforms with a Variety of Options
One of the most well-known websites offering a comprehensive selection of planning sheets is Canva. It provides a vast array of designs, from simple layouts to more intricate structures. You can easily modify the layouts to match your preferences, adjusting colors, fonts, and styles. Canva also offers templates for various devices, making it accessible across different platforms.
High-Quality Design Resources
Microsoft Office offers many downloadable planning sheets through its suite of applications like Word and Excel. These designs are easy to use and are perfect for those who need a structured approach to their tasks. The website ensures the templates are adaptable and functional, with a focus on simplicity and productivity.
Another notable platform is Vertex42, which provides templates focused on helping individuals and businesses manage their tasks more effectively. Whether you’re managing projects or personal goals, Vertex42’s selection of customizable layouts is perfect for anyone in need of an organized approach.

Sharing Printable Calendars with Others
Sharing time-management tools with others can help ensure everyone stays on the same page. Whether for personal use or work-related activities, distributing these resources makes it easier to organize plans collectively. There are several effective ways to share such resources that allow flexibility and accessibility for everyone involved.
Methods of Distribution
- Email: One of the most straightforward methods for sharing is via email. Simply attach the document as a file, and recipients can print or view it as needed.
- Cloud Storage: Uploading to cloud services like Google Drive or Dropbox allows others to access the file from anywhere. This method is ideal for collaboration and updates.
- Social Media: If you’re working on a project that involves a group, sharing via a private group or direct messaging on platforms like Facebook or Slack can help distribute the information quickly.
Considerations for Sharing
- File Format: Ensure the document is in a format that is easily accessible to others, such as PDF or Word. This ensures compatibility across devices and operating systems.
- Permissions: When using cloud storage or email, make sure to check the privacy settings and permissions so only authorized individuals can access or edit the file.
- Update Frequency: Be mindful of how often updates are necessary. If the document is regularly changing, it’s better to share a link to the cloud version rather than repeatedly sending attachments.
